Tobradex Eye Drops: A Powerful Combination
Tobradex eye drops contain two active ingredients: tobramycin, an antibiotic, and dexamethasone, a corticosteroid. Tobramycin works by killing bacteria that cause eye infections, while dexamethasone reduces inflammation and swelling. This combination provides a comprehensive treatment approach for eye infections, addressing both the bacterial cause and the inflammatory response.

Usage and Dosage
Tobradex eye drops are typically prescribed by a healthcare professional and should be used as directed. The usual dosage is one to two drops in the affected eye(s) every 4-6 hours. It is essential to complete the full course of treatment, even if symptoms improve before finishing the medication.

Precautions and Contraindications
Tobradex eye drops should not be used in patients with a history of hypersensitivity to tobramycin, dexamethasone, or any other component of the medication. Additionally, patients with certain medical conditions, such as glaucoma or viral eye infections, may need to use Tobradex eye drops with caution.
